Duties

  • Develops, implements and manages aviation safety oversight plans (assessments, validations, audits and inspections) for individuals, enterprises, organizations and Minister’s delegates.
  • Exercises Ministerial delegation of authority under the Aeronautics Act and the Canadian Aviation Regulations (CARs), and manages oversight of delegations to others.
  • Manages risk identification, assessment and documentation, and recommends / implements risk management solutions.
  • As a subject matter expert in flight operations, communicates with Accountable Executives, senior managers and enterprise representatives on all aspects of the Civil Aviation safety oversight program.
  • Identifies cross-functional issues and engages subject matter experts regionally, nationally and internationally to deliver the oversight program.
  • Oversees horizontal integration of the Civil Aviation safety oversight program within a matrix management model.
  • Influences and promotes governmental and Civil Aviation priorities across technical specialties.
  • Maintains pilot qualifications for operational duties and Professional Aviation Currency through flight or simulator programs.

    Information you must provide

    Essential qualifications

  • A secondary school diploma (high school) or employer-approved alternatives (see Note 1).
  • Possession of a Restricted Radio-Telephone Operator Certificate (endorsed Aeronautical).
  • One of the following licences : Canadian Airline Transport Pilot Licence - Aeroplane (Group 1 Instrument Rating, currency, and medical) or Canadian Commercial Pilot Licence - Helicopter (Group IV Instrument Rating, currency, and medical).
  • Recent and significant experience as a pilot with a commercial operator, flight training unit or relevant Canadian Aviation Regulations / certifications. Definition : recent within last 7 years; significant = minimum 3 years of experience.
  • Total of 2,500 hours flight time, including 1,000 hours as pilot-in-command, with 500 hours in multi-engine aircraft, or 500 hours in medium / heavy category helicopters.
  • Other qualifications

    Holds or has held a flight instructor class 1 rating (aeroplane or helicopter); PIC experience in multi-engine helicopters; training pilot experience; leadership experience in an air operator environment.
